Título: | Advances in HOSM control design and implementation for PEM fuel cell systems |
Autor: | Kunusch, Cristian CSIC; Puleston, Pablo Federico; Mayosky, Miguel Ángel; Serra, Maria CSIC ORCID | Fecha de publicación: | 2009 | Citación: | MMAR 2009 | Resumen: | A second order sliding mode strategy to control the air supply and oxygen stoichiometry of a fuel cell based generation system is presented. The control design is accomplished from a complete model of a experimental plant that was previously developed by the authors and specially suited for nonlinear control issues. The resulting controller endows the system with enhanced dynamic characteristics and robustness to model uncertainties and external disturbances. Simulations and experimental results are provided, showing the feasibility and reliability of the approach. | Descripción: | Presentado al 14th International Conference on Methods and Models in Automation and Robotics celebrado en Polonia del 19 al 21 de agosto de 2009. | URI: | http://hdl.handle.net/10261/30108 |
